All of us experience being wronged as we move through life. Scripture is clear that when we decide to take matters into our own hands and focus on getting even with others, we are the ones doing wrong. God asks us to resist the temptation to get even with those who have wronged us. How? By waiting on Him to do what is in our best interest and in the best interest of others. Where is God asking you to humbly and confidently wait on Him?

Don’t say, “I will get even for this wrong.” Wait for the Lord to handle the matter. -Proverbs 20:22

Prayer: Jesus, when I am wronged, let me see You on the cross. Transform my heart and my mind as I meditate on Your humility and willingness to trust the Father’s greater purpose when others did wrong to You. Thank You for choosing grace and forgiveness instead of vengeance, and so bringing life out of death. In Your name I pray, amen.
